This bridge carries Bridge Street (which here forms the A941 public road) over the River Lossie on the N side of Elgin (NJ26SW 91). The river here forms the boundary between the parishes of Elgin (to the SE) and Spynie (to the N and W).

Information from RCAHMS (RJCM), 28 March 2006.

Photographic Survey (22 November 2010 - 25 November 2010)

A photographic and written record together with a general plan of the Bishopmills Bridge was undertaken prior to works associated with the Flood Alleviation Scheme. The Bridge is a Category B Listed structure and was constructed in ca. 1873 by John Willet and is of iron and stone construction, replacing an earlier bridge which stood in its position.

Information from Oasis (aocarcha1-92262) 21 August 2013
